Pro-Tools adding extra audio information??
I've been having problems with a program that I use to turn powerpoints into webpages for people to easily view online. Anyway it takes .wav files and will convert them. However when I try to use it with simple stereo 16 bit 44.1k files I get errors.
I know this sounds like the other program has a problem right? Where here is the twist. I pull the waves into soundforge, and it tells me that my files has extra audio information and asks if I would like to strip the files. Once I strip the files of this "extra audio information" they work fine with my converter. What is the extra information that is being used and should this really interfeir with other audio programs using the files?? Maybe not the right place to ask this but I have a 002 so I thought it woudl be valid. : ) |
